Actor Mohan Babu filmed a thrilling action sequence for "Gayatri".
He shot it at the Ramoji Film City.
"It was an absolute happiness to direct an obsessive artist like him and see him perform," Kanal Kannan, the film's action director, said in a statement.
Mohan Babu performed the stunt rig action sequence with style, and a lot of planning and practice was involved in order to minimise the risks, Kannan said.
Nero Motion control rig is being used for adding visual effects in "Gayatri", in which Mohan Babu plays the hero as well as the villain. This rig is used to capture the fight sequence between the two of them.
According to the statement, the film's makers had especially flown in a stunt rig from Australia, coupled with a well-planned stunt design and stunt co-ordinators, to create a unique visual spectacle for a fight scene.
The fight sequence is being shot for the last eight days and will continue for another three days. The shooting was halted for four days because of the birth of Mohan Babu's son Vishnu Manchu's baby.
Vishnu Manchu also features in "Gayatri" as a romantic character opposite Shriya Saran. The film will release on February 9.
